On Sunday, 21 of December 2008, Thomas Gleixner wrote: > On Thu, 18 Dec 2008, Rafael J. Wysocki wrote: > > > On Thursday, 18 of December 2008, Ingo Molnar wrote: > > > > > > * Peter Zijlstra <peterz@infradead.org> wrote: > > > > > > > Rafael, would something like this explain why we had to revert Shaggy's > > > > patch? > > > > Well, I have yet to understand what the suspend-resume of the timekeeping code > > actually does. > > Thats rather simple: > > suspend() saves the current time of the persistent clock (if > available), forwards the timekeeping variables so they can be reused > on resume, disables timekeeping activities and shuts down the clock > events layer. > > resume() estimates the suspend time via persistent clock (if > available) and update xtime with the sleep length. After that it > reactivates timekeeping and resumes clock events and high resolution > timers. > > So the sole purpose is: > - dis/enable timekeeping and clock event devices. > - keep track of the suspend time (if a persistent clock is available) > > We reactivate clock event devices and hrtimers from timekeeping_resume > because clock events depend on functional timekeeping.
Thanks for the explanation. In fact, the reactivation of clock event devices and hrtimers is the part I'm not familiar with.
> > The original description sounds worrisome to me, it looks like we've overlooked > > something at least. > > Care to explain ?
Well, the fact that in the resume code path the clocksource is only updated as a result of executing pci_set_power_state() is worrisome. I would be more reliable to update it directly at one point.
